SA's economic trouble | Pets not escaping inflation

JOHANNESBURG - Pet lovers are struggling with the increasing cost of living.

This has also affected the prices of dog and cat food, forcing them to dig deeper into their pockets.

In some cases, it gets so bad that they can no longer afford to keep them.

The NSPCA is urging people to rather give them up for adoption rather than letting them suffer.

"Rather than letting the animal suffer just call us. The NSPCA will always do their utmost best to find homes that are suitable," said Wrolien Rabie

"If you know you cannot look after yourself and the pet consider the adoption process.

"We know most people think of their pets as their kids. So call us and we will find a home that you would like your child to have gone back to."
